Discovery of 'suspicious' vehicle leads to police chase in Mt. Juliet

Published on: 05/10/2025

Description

MT. JULIET, Tenn. (WKRN) -- A Nashvillian was taken into custody Saturday afternoon following a foot chase between two Mt. Juliet shopping centers.

The Mt. Juliet Police Department said an officer noticed a "suspicious, running vehicle" that was left unattended for over an hour at the Providence Marketplace Kroger on Saturday, May 10. After making that observation, the officer reportedly discovered the car had a false license plate displayed.

When the vehicle's occupant returned, authorities said they approached to ask about the tag. However, the man allegedly ran away, sparking a pursuit that crossed Providence Parkway and ended near Jonathan's Grille, where police safely took him into custody.

The suspect -- described by officials as a 23-year-old man from Nashville -- faces multiple charges, including evading arrest, resisting arrest, driving without a license, and possession of drug paraphernalia.

Not only did law enforcement seize a temporary tag, but they discovered the vehicle had been unregistered for more than 18 months, according to law enforcement.

"We appreciate our vigilant officers, always keeping an eye on our community so that our community can thrive, feel safe, and live without fear," MJPD posted on social media. "We focus on crime, so our residents and visitors don’t have to deal with crime."

No additional details have been released about Saturday's incident, including the identity of the man who was apprehended.
